Here's my info on this. Location: Ferry(Selbina/Mhaura) Rod: Halycon Bait: Shrimp Lure
My skill was at 18 when I was fishing for Nebimonites. Out of 5 trips on the Ferry I caught (9)Noble Lady and (18)Nebimonite. Canceled all catches with "!!!" message, also most "Bad feelings". Out of the 5 "Bad feelings" I had, I snapped my line 1 time, caught (3)Noble Lady and (1) Neb~. Only received 0.2 skill up total during the hour or so on the ferry.
This fish is a very good gil profit. You can catch on ferry in selbina/mhaura with hume/composite rod and a minnow/sinking minnow/shrimp lure. I would recomend a minnow because they are cheap and sold on the ferry. They cap at ~65.
